Food & Craft
All of the hard work on the smallholding comes to fruition in the produce. Much of it can be enjoyed as it is - there isn't much better than a crisp apple straight from the tree, or a handful of freshly podded peas - and more still benefits from a little bit of processing.
In this section we look at the food and drink produced from a smallholding, with recipes, and some handy cookery guides, animal products like fleeces, and wool, and the processes that go into turning them into something much more useful and valuable.
